Police Parade 13 Suspected Cultists in Kwara
No fewer than 13 suspected cultists were monday paraded by the Kwara State police command for allegedly involving in various cult clashes in Ilorin, the state capital.
Rival cult clashes at the weekend allegedly claimed the lives of four persons in the Ilorin metropolis. The clashes were said to have been sparked by a supremacy battle between the two gangs.
Items recovered from the suspects included one cut-to-size gun; one locally made pistol and five cartridges.
Parading the suspect before journalists in Ilorin yesterday, state police commissioner, Mr. Sam Okaula, however said that three persons actually lost their lives during the street brawls that happened between the two cult gangs at the weekend in Ilorin
Okaula said the state police command had earlier declared two of the arrested suspects wanted.
According to him: "There were rival cult clashes between Saturday and Sunday and some people lost their lives. But like I told you the last time, we will always be on top of the situation; we have effected the arrest of 13 of these notorious cultists. We shall go all out to arrest more of these suspects so that we can have peace in the state."
He said: "The ones arrested have made useful statement and are undergoing interrogation. We will definitely proceed against them.
"They keep on devising means of attacking their victims. Of recent they have been making use of motorcycles otherwise known as 'Okada'; they also telephone some of these victims luring them to obscure corners and areas where they attack them. But we have this information at our disposals."
Okuala added: "Consequently, we have directed District Police Officers (DPOs) and Area Commanders to be on top of the situation.
"We are going to carry out effective checks of these motorcycles; as most of them are being used to commit crime. We are also going to hit them hard; we are going to ensure that we check their activities."
